= Circular No.32 of 2020 GOVERNMENT OF INDIA (भारत सरकार) MINISTRY OF RAILWAYS (रेल मंत्रालय) (RAILWAY BOARD रेलवे बोर्ड) No.TC-1/2020/101/efile/1 New Delhi, dt.11.12.2020 General Manager All Zonal Railways Sub: Guidelines regarding premium indent Ref: Chapter-II of Goods Tariff No.41 Part-I (Vol-I) Please refer to Chapter-II of Goods Tariff regarding rules for the registration of indent, allotment and supply of wagons. The matter has been examined and competent authority has decided to stipulate following guidelines regarding premium indent, by inserting an additional Para 201 (21) in the Chapter-II of Goods Tariff No.41 Part-I (Vol-I), as given below- “201 (21) Premium indent- a. The scheme shall be optional. b. In sidings, the customer can indicate a date of supply of rakes and also indicate whether he will load if the rake is supplied after due date on Normal tariff rate. c. The customer shall be required to pay 5% premium on normal freight which shall be deposited in advance. If the rake is supplied later than the indicated date on the indent, the premium paid will be adjusted against the normal freight. d. In the goods shed also, customer will be permitted to place premium indent. Customer will get priority for allocation on two days as notified under Preferential Traffic Order issued by Traffic Transportation directorate of Railway Board from time to time. However, on other days normal order of priority of indents will follow. e. Premium Indent once placed cannot be withdrawn; withdrawal of the indent shall invite forfeiture of the premium paid. f. This premium indent policy will not be applicable to restricted destinations and destinations regulated by quota.” This issues in consultation with Traffic Transportation directorate and with the concurrence of Finance directorate of Ministry of Railways.
